Hamilton Accies boss hails 'talisman' striker he worked hard to sign

Hamilton Accies boss John Rankin has labelled striker Oli Shaw as a ‘talisman’ after the former Hibs striker last week became summer signing number five.

Rankin is delighted to bring the 26-year-old in on a three-year deal from Barnsley, and reckons he’s a star that can help his side to Championship title glory.

The New Douglas Park gaffer has been pleased with pre-season – a serious knee injury sustained by Fergus Owens aside – and reckons his side is ready for the campaign ahead. And while Rankin wants to try and get out of their Premier Sports Cup group stage, he admits it will be an extension of pre-season.

On Shaw, Rankin said: “The three strikers that we have in Oli, Euan Henderson and Kevin O’Hara, I’m really pleased with. Last season I felt we had a lot of strikers on our books, but how many actually contributed by scoring a good amount of goals.

“In that aspect, I thought ‘can we get one that is really important in the dressing room, that is a talisman’, and I think with Oli we’ve done that.

“We put a lot of work into that in the summer to try and get Oli over the line and, to be fair to Oli, he had more lucrative offers elsewhere, but wanted to come and play football.

“We wanted someone like him, who would commit to the club for a long time, hence the three-year contract. It’s really pleasing for us that we’ve got someone of that calibre at the football club, who has been in the Championship before, who has won the league before – but not only that, the athleticism and the professionalism he brings, so I’m thrilled to get him.

“I spoke to the players and told them we want to bring one in that everyone benefits from, and brings everyone that wee bit of excitement.
